This study aims to examine the effects of key elements of exhibitors’ satisfaction on positive behavior intention in the metaverse environment of a trade show context. We set word of mouth and willingness to return as predictive behavioral intention regressed by satisfaction - satisfaction with selfperformance and satisfaction with metaverse environment (immersion), in detail. To collect data, a virtual metaverse trade show environment is created based on Gather Town, a metaverse platform for conference meetings. This work-inprogress paper contains detail information on research motivation, hypotheses, environment settings, and empirical study plans. Data will be collected from multiple companies participating in the International Sourcing Fair 2021 in Seoul. We expect that this study will introduce a new way of predicting exhibitor’s business innovation through the application of metaverse trade shows without any hurdle of the Pandemic.
